Harnessing the Power of Azure SQL Database for Modern Applications

 


In the era of digital transformation, businesses are increasingly relying on data-driven insights to fuel their growth and innovation. Microsoft Azure SQL Database stands out as a leading solution for organizations looking to leverage the power of cloud-based relational databases. As a fully managed Database-as-a-Service (DBaaS), Azure SQL Database offers a range of features that streamline database management, enhance performance, and ensure robust security. This article explores the key benefits of Azure SQL Database and how it can transform your data management strategy.

What is Azure SQL Database?

Azure SQL Database is a cloud-based relational database service built on the latest stable version of Microsoft SQL Server. It provides a scalable, high-performance platform for developing and hosting applications without the complexity of managing physical infrastructure. With Azure SQL Database, organizations can focus on building applications while Microsoft handles the underlying database management tasks such as provisioning, backups, and updates.

Key Features and Benefits

  1. Scalability and Elasticity: One of the standout features of Azure SQL Database is its ability to scale dynamically. Organizations can adjust their database resources on the fly, accommodating varying workloads without downtime. This elasticity is particularly beneficial for businesses with fluctuating demands, allowing them to optimize costs while ensuring performance.

  2. High Availability and Disaster Recovery: Azure SQL Database guarantees high availability with a service-level agreement (SLA) of up to 99.995%. Built-in features such as automatic backups, geo-replication, and failover groups ensure that your data remains accessible and protected against disasters. This level of reliability is critical for businesses that depend on continuous access to their data.

  3. Advanced Security Features: Security is paramount in today’s digital landscape, and Azure SQL Database offers comprehensive security measures. These include advanced threat protection, data encryption at rest and in transit, and integration with Azure Active Directory for authentication. Organizations can implement fine-grained access controls to safeguard sensitive information, ensuring compliance with industry regulations.

  4. Intelligent Performance Optimization: Azure SQL Database includes built-in intelligence that continuously monitors performance and makes recommendations for optimization. Features such as automatic tuning, which adjusts query performance based on usage patterns, help maintain optimal efficiency without manual intervention. This allows developers to focus on application development rather than database maintenance.

  5. Cost-Effective Pricing Models: Azure SQL Database offers flexible pricing options, including single databases and elastic pools. Organizations can choose the model that best fits their needs, allowing for cost-effective resource allocation. The pay-as-you-go pricing structure ensures that businesses only pay for the resources they consume, making it easier to manage budgets.

Use Cases for Azure SQL Database

Azure SQL Database is versatile and can be applied to various scenarios, including:

  • Web and Mobile Applications: Use Azure SQL Database to power web and mobile applications that require a reliable and scalable backend, ensuring seamless user experiences.

  • Business Intelligence and Analytics: Leverage the database’s capabilities to store and analyze large volumes of data, enabling organizations to derive actionable insights and make informed decisions.

  • SaaS Applications: Build Software as a Service (SaaS) applications that require multi-tenant architectures, taking advantage of Azure SQL Database’s scalability and security features.

  • Data Warehousing: Utilize Azure SQL Database for data warehousing solutions, integrating with Azure Data Factory and Azure Synapse Analytics for advanced analytics and reporting.



Conclusion

Azure SQL Database is a powerful and flexible solution for organizations looking to harness the full potential of their data. With its robust features, including scalability, high availability, advanced security, and intelligent performance optimization, Azure SQL Database empowers businesses to innovate and grow in a competitive landscape. By embracing Azure SQL Database, organizations can streamline their data management processes, reduce operational overhead, and focus on delivering value to their customers. In a world where data is king, Azure SQL Database provides the foundation for success.


No comments:

Post a Comment

Developing an Incident Response Plan: Key Components for Quickly Addressing Security Breaches

  In today’s digital landscape, cybersecurity threats are not just a possibility; they are a reality that organizations must confront. With ...